var React = require('react');
/**
* Timesheet Bubble
*/
var Bubble = function(wMonth, min, start, end) {
this.min = min;
this.start = start;
this.end = end;
this.widthMonth = wMonth;
};
/**
* Format month number
*/
Bubble.prototype.formatMonth = function(num) {
num = parseInt(num, 10);
return num >= 10 ? num : '0' + num;
};
/**
* Calculate starting offset for bubble
*/
Bubble.prototype.getStartOffset = function() {
return (this.widthMonth/12) * (12 * (this.start.getFullYear() - this.min) + this.start.getMonth());
};
/**
* Get count of full years from start to end
*/
Bubble.prototype.getFullYears = function() {
return ((this.end && this.end.getFullYear()) || this.start.getFullYear()) - this.start.getFullYear();
};
/**
* Get count of all months in Timesheet Bubble
*/
Bubble.prototype.getMonths = function() {
var fullYears = this.getFullYears();
var months = 0;
if (!this.end) {
months += !this.start.hasMonth ? 12 : 1;
} else {
if (!this.end.hasMonth) {
months += 12 - (this.start.hasMonth ? this.start.getMonth() : 0);
months += 12 * (fullYears-1 > 0 ? fullYears-1 : 0);
} else {
months += this.end.getMonth() + 1;
months += 12 - (this.start.hasMonth ? this.start.getMonth() : 0);
months += 12 * (fullYears-1);
}
}
return months;
};
/**
* Get bubble's width in pixel
*/
Bubble.prototype.getWidth = function() {
return (this.widthMonth/12) * this.getMonths();
};
/**
* Get the bubble's label
*/
Bubble.prototype.getDateLabel = function() {
return [
(this.start.hasMonth ? this.formatMonth(this.start.getMonth() + 1) + '/' : '' ) + this.start.getFullYear(),
(this.end ? '-' + ((this.end.hasMonth ? this.formatMonth(this.end.getMonth() + 1) + '/' : '' ) + this.end.getFullYear()) : '')
].join('');
};
/**
* Parse data string
*/
function parseDate(date) {
if (date.indexOf('/') === -1) {
date = new Date(parseInt(date, 10), 0, 1);
date.hasMonth = false;
} else {
date = date.split('/');
date = new Date(parseInt(date[1], 10), parseInt(date[0], 10)-1, 1);
date.hasMonth = true;
}
return date;
};
